    Abstract: The present disclosure is directed to controlling outcomes in a game that includes multiple different users playing respective roles of specific virtual characters. The multiple different users may be present at a same physical location, or the different users may be located at different physical locations when movement of their eyes is tracked. Here, a user may choose one of a set of provided selections by simply looking at the chosen selection for a period of time or by looking at the chosen selection and performing an action or gesture. This functionality allows multiple different users to control actions performed by different specific characters via an online multiplayer system. Depending on what a first user looks at, that first user or a second user may be provided with a corresponding set of selections or audio/visual content via respective gaming devices operated by the first and the second user.

    Abstract: A computer simulation may include a tabletop game in which multiple players each wearing a head-mounted display (HMD) view a tabletop projector housing with a different aspect of the game for each side of the housing. A projector assembly may be inside the housing. The housing may be a screen that unfolds into cube, and the projector projects light in all four screens so that everyone gets different perspective. A player may be enabled to switch between perspectives for different player's angles.

    Abstract: A system and method for tracking digital assets associated with video games. The digital assets may be in-game digital assets, such as in-game items or characters. The digital assets may be video game digital media assets representing moments of gameplay of a video game, such as video clips or images. The digital asset is created, and a distributed ledger tracking a history of the digital asset is created and stored across devices. A unique token for the digital asset can include a unique identifier and metadata identifying properties of the digital asset. Changes to properties of the digital asset, such as ownership, visual appearance, or metadata, can be identified in a request to update the history. A new block can be generated for, and appended to, the distributed ledger identifying the changes to the history of the digital asset. The new block can include hashes of previous blocks.

    Abstract: Methods and systems are provided for placing or moving a virtual menu (e.g., virtual object) to an adjusted virtual position within a virtual reality scene based on the ability of a user. The method includes capturing, by a computing system, head mounted display (HMD) gameplay by a user of a video game being executed on the computing system. The HMD presents virtual reality scene to the user. The method includes monitoring, by the computing system, physical actions of the user while the user is wearing the HMD and interacting with the virtual reality scene during the gameplay. The method includes identifying, by the computing system, an attempt by the user to make an input at a virtual object in the virtual reality scene based on the physical actions. The method includes generating, by the computing system, a movement of the virtual object from an initial virtual position in the virtual reality scene to an adjusted virtual position in the virtual reality scene. The movement has a virtual distance and a virtual direction that is predicted for the user based a model of interactivity of the user to enable said input with the virtual object. In this way, a virtual menu (e.g., virtual object) is dynamically placed or moved to a virtual position in the virtual reality scene that can be accessible by the user.
